The Morning After

J Records

In 1998, Deborah Cox hit platinum and gold with "We Can't Be Friends" and "Nobody's Supposed to Be Here." The 13 melodies in The Morning After are the most personal yet from this pop-soul goddess. These aren't just la-la love tunes; a refreshing candor...
